Share via


Création ou modification du formulaire par défaut d'une entité

 

S’applique à : Dynamics 365 (online), Dynamics 365 (on-premises), Dynamics CRM 2013, Dynamics CRM 2015, Dynamics CRM Online, Dynamics CRM 2016

Lorsque vous créez un formulaire pour une entité, il est de type Principal. Lorsqu’il s’ouvre, il est identique au formulaire nommé Informations. +Vous pouvez ajouter ou modifier des champs, des sections, des onglets, la navigation et des propriétés associées, puis enregistrer le formulaire.

Cette procédure s'applique à tout formulaire dont le type de formulaire est Principal. Chaque formulaire principal est composé d'un ou de plusieurs onglets. Chaque onglet peut contenir une ou plusieurs sections. Chaque section contient un ou plusieurs champs ou IFRAMES.

Si vous souhaitez baser votre nouveau formulaire sur un formulaire existant, vous pouvez en dupliquer un.

  1. Assurez-vous de disposer du rôle de sécurité Administrateur système ou Personnalisateur de système ou d'autorisations équivalentes.

    Consultation de votre rôle de sécurité

    • Suivez les étapes de la section Afficher votre profil utilisateur.

    • Vous ne disposez pas des autorisations appropriées ? Contactez votre administrateur système.

  2. Accédez à Paramètres > Personnalisations.

  3. Choisissez Personnaliser le système.

  4. Sous Composants, développez Entités, développez l’entité dont vous voulez modifier le formulaire principal, puis cliquez sur Formulaires.

  5. Pour créer un formulaire, dans la barre de commandes, cliquez sur Nouveau.

    - ou -

    Pour modifier un formulaire existant, double-cliquez ou appuyez sur un formulaire dont le type de formulaire est Principal.

  6. Modifiez l'apparence du formulaire de l'une des façons suivantes, si nécessaire :

    • Ajouter un onglet à un formulaire

    • Ajouter une section à un formulaire

    • Ajouter un champ à un formulaire

    • Ajouter ou modifier un formulaire d’IFRAME

    • Ajouter ou modifier une sous-grille dans un formulaire

    • Ajouter ou modifier une ressource Web de formulaire

    • Ajouter ou modifier la navigation du formulaire pour les entités associées

    • Modifier les en-têtes et pieds de page de formulaire

    • Supprimer un onglet, une section, un champ ou un IFRAME

    • Activer ou désactiver l’Assistant Formulaire

    Pour plus d'informations, voir TechNet : Personnalisation de votre système Dynamics 365.

  7. Modifiez les propriétés de parties du formulaire, selon les besoins :

    • Modifier les propriétés d’un formulaire

    • Modifier les propriétés d’un champ de formulaire

    • Modifier les propriétés d’un onglet

    • Modifier les propriétés d’une section

    Pour plus d'informations, voir TechNet : Personnalisation de votre système Dynamics 365.

  8. Ajoutez des scripts d’événements selon les besoins.

  9. Déterminez les rôles de sécurité susceptibles d’afficher le formulaire.Pour plus d'informations : Attribuer des rôles de sécurité à un formulaire

  10. Affichez un aperçu de la façon dont le formulaire principal s’affiche et comment les événements fonctionnent :

    1. Sous l’onglet Accueil, cliquez sur Aperçu, puis sélectionnez Créer un formulaire, Formulaire de mise à jour ou Formulaire en lecture seule.

    2. Pour fermer le formulaire Aperçu, dans le menu Fichier, cliquez sur Fermer.

  11. Une fois la modification du formulaire terminée, cliquez sur Enregistrer sous. Entrez un nom pour le formulaire, puis cliquez sur OK.

  12. Une fois vos personnalisations terminées, publiez-les :

    • Pour publier les personnalisations uniquement pour le composant en cours de modification, sous Composants, cliquez sur l'entité que vous utilisiez, puis sur Publier.

    • Pour publier les personnalisations pour tous les composants non publiés en même temps, sous Composants cliquez sur Entités, puis sur la barre d'outils Actions, cliquez sur Publier toutes les personnalisations.

Notes

  • Vous ne pouvez pas appliquer de niveau requis à un champ à l’aide de ce formulaire. Les contraintes de niveau requis sont appliquées à l’attribut.

  • Avant de supprimer un champ d'un formulaire, assurez-vous que ce champ n'est pas un champ obligatoire pour d'autres composants ou scripts personnalisés. Par exemple, le formulaire d’opportunité nécessite le champ Tarifs pour déterminer le tarif à utiliser lorsqu’un produit est ajouté à cette opportunité. La suppression du champ Tarifs empêche l’ajout d’un nouveau produit à une opportunité.

  • Lorsque vous ajoutez un champ de groupe d'options dans le formulaire, la liste déroulante qui contient les valeurs du groupe d'options ne peut afficher que deux valeurs. Les utilisateurs doivent faire défiler pour afficher plus de valeurs dans la liste. Si vous souhaitez afficher plus de deux valeurs sans que les utilisateurs aient à faire défiler, ajoutez un ou plusieurs contrôles Espacement sous le champ de groupe d'options dans le formulaire. Chaque contrôle Espacement fournit un espace pour une valeur de groupe d'options supplémentaire. Par exemple, si vous souhaitez afficher quatre valeurs dans la liste déroulante sans défilement, ajoutez deux contrôles Espacement sous le champ de groupe d'options dans le formulaire.

  • Chaque fois que vous modifiez des éléments de l’interface utilisateur ou que vous implémentez des scripts de formulaire pour une entité, vous devez publier les modifications pour les appliquer. Toutes les personnalisations qui modifient le schéma de données de Microsoft Dynamics 365, telles que les entités, les relations ou les champs personnalisés, sont appliquées immédiatement.

  • Vous ne pouvez pas utiliser l'éditeur de formulaires pour modifier le style visuel des formulaires, tel que le style de police, la taille de police ou les couleurs utilisés dans le formulaire. La modification des pages de feuilles de style en cascade (CSS, Cascading Style Sheets) dans l’application Web ou des propriétés de style du formulaire par le biais de scripts n’est pas prise en charge.

  • L'installation de personnalisations de la solution ou de la publication peuvent compromettre le fonctionnement normal du système. Nous vous recommandons de planifier l'importation d'une solution au moment le moins perturbant pour les utilisateurs.

Voir aussi

Création ou modification des attributs d'entités
TechNet : Personnalisation de votre système Dynamics 365
TechNet : création et conception de formulaires